Best Season Viewership in Seven Years, Averaging 18.005 Million Viewers Through Week 11

CBS Sports’ Most-Watched Game of Season and Best Week 11 Game Window since NFL Returned to CBS in 1998, Averaging 27.546 Million Viewers

Paramount+ Has Its Most-Streamed NFL Season through Week 11

The NFL ON CBS continues to set record viewership across all platforms this season with another strong performance in Week 11, highlighted by its most-watched game window of the season.

CBS Sports is delivering its best season viewership since 2015, averaging 18.005 million viewers through Week 11.

Sunday’s national game window, with Cowboys-Vikings and Bengals-Steelers, is the Network’s most-watched Week 11 game window since the NFL returned to CBS in 1998, averaging 27.546 million viewers. Along with Week Two’s national game window (led by Bengals-Cowboys, 27.391 million viewers), the NFL ON CBS has surpassed 27 million viewers twice this season, the most of any network.

The regional game window, led by Eagles-Colts, averaged 15.257 million viewers and is CBS’ most-watched regional game window in November in six years.

Paramount+, featuring live NFL ON CBS local market games, has recorded its most-streamed NFL season through the first 11 weeks and scored double-digit year-over-year growth in households, minutes and average minute audience (AMA) vs. last year’s comparable weekend.
